
Revolutionizing Tech: The Rise of Generative AI

Generative AI, a subfield of artificial intelligence, is rapidly changing the technological landscape. Unlike traditional AI which focuses on analyzing data, generative AI creates new data, ranging from text and images to audio and video. This transformative technology is impacting various sectors, promising to revolutionize how we interact with technology and the world around us.
Understanding Generative AI
At its core, generative AI leverages sophisticated algorithms, often based on deep learning models like Generative Adversarial Networks (GANs) and transformers, to generate outputs that resemble real-world data. These algorithms learn patterns and structures from input data and then use this knowledge to create new, similar data points. The quality of the generated output depends heavily on the quality and quantity of the training data, as well as the sophistication of the model architecture.
Key Applications of Generative AI
- Image Generation: Generative AI is creating stunningly realistic images, from photorealistic portraits to fantastical landscapes. This has applications in advertising, gaming, and art.
- Text Generation: Tools like ChatGPT demonstrate the power of generative AI in creating human-quality text. This has applications in content creation, customer service chatbots, and even code generation.
- Audio and Video Generation: AI is now capable of generating realistic audio and video content, opening up possibilities in film production, music creation, and personalized virtual experiences.
- Drug Discovery: Generative AI accelerates drug discovery by generating potential drug candidates, significantly reducing the time and cost of development.
- Personalized Education: AI can generate personalized learning materials and adapt to individual student needs, enhancing the educational experience.

Challenges and Ethical Considerations
Despite its potential, generative AI also presents several challenges:
- Bias and Fairness: AI models trained on biased data can perpetuate and amplify existing societal biases.
- Misinformation and Deepfakes: The ability to generate realistic fake content raises concerns about misinformation and the potential for malicious use.
- Job Displacement: Automation driven by generative AI could lead to job displacement in certain sectors.
- Intellectual Property Rights: Questions around ownership and copyright of AI-generated content remain unresolved.
Addressing these ethical considerations is crucial for responsible development and deployment of generative AI.
